Cheese, Bacon & Chive Scones

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tablespoon sugar
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1⁄2 teaspoon salt
- 1⁄4 teaspoon pepper
- 1 pinch cayenne pepper (optional)
- 1⁄3 cup butter, chilled and cut into 12 pieces
- 3⁄4 cup milk, room temperature
- 1 cup sharp cheddar cheese, grated
- 4 slices bacon, cooked, cooled and chopped into small pieces
- 1 tablespoon chives, finely chopped
- 1 large egg, beaten
- 1 tablespoon milk
directions
- Preheat oven to 400 °F
- Line a baking pan with parchment paper
- Make glaze by combining beaten egg with 1 tbsp milk. Set aside.
- In a large bowl wh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, salt and pepper.
- Cut butter into flour mixture using a pastry blender, until m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
- Add the grated cheese, chopped cooked bacon and chives to the dry ingredients.
- Make a well in the center of the dry ingredients, add the milk, and stir gently with a wooden spoon, until mixture just forms a ball.
- Place the dough on a lightly floured surface and knead until smooth.
- Roll or pat dough 1 inch thick and using a floured 2 1/2 inch cutter, cut out rounds.
- Place on the prepared baking pan and brush with glaze.
- Sprinkle 1 teaspoon of grated cheddar cheese on the top of each scone (if desired).
- Bake in preheated oven for 15 minutes or until lightly browned on top and cheese has melted
- Cool on wire rack.
